Can glass jade be poured with beer water?Generally, glass jade can be watered with beer, because beer contains relatively rich nutrients, and watering glass jade with beer can replace the role of fertilizer. This can not only save costs but also promote the rapid growth and flowering of glass jade. Therefore, you can use some beer to water glass jade appropriately. How to pour beer into glassBeer is generally more suitable for watering glass jade. When using beer to water glass jade, be careful not to use beer directly. It should be mixed evenly with clean water before watering, so as not to cause its roots to be burned. In addition, generally speaking, do not water glass jade with too much beer at one time, otherwise there will be water accumulation, affecting its normal growth. What to do if you pour too much beer in the glassGenerally, when using beer to water glass jade, if you accidentally water it too much at one time, you should stop watering and use beer water in time, and then place the glass jade in a well-ventilated place for maintenance, which can speed up the evaporation of water. At the same time, we need to give it more light and loosen the soil appropriately, which can help the evaporation of water. Generally, it will resume growth after a few days of maintenance. |
